If they are around strangers they can be aggressive. The temperament of these creatures does not match the cute and cuddly features they portray. Many owners report that even after the bond is established they are careful not to stick their hands in the cage too aggressively-as to not get bitten. Once they do bond with their owner they can be held, but even then they still may bite. They have only recently been bred as pets in the U.S. They can be aggressive until they bond with their owner. This will protect the emotional health of your pet and spare you the money and stress of having to deal with a self-mutilating animal! If you get different sexes you will need to neuter the male. This is important! If you want to get a sugar glider then you should get two. It’s best to house them in family groups of 2-6. They must have several hours of socialization each day with other sugar gliders. They are very emotional and very moody creatures.

If housed by themselves they are known to self-mutilate! They can cause a lot of damage to themselves which will require immediate veterinary care. They should not be purchased by themselves and kept as pets. Sugar gliders are extremely social creatures and should be purchased together in groups or pairs. Here are some important things you should consider: Sugar Gliders Should Be Purchased in Groups Or Pairs It’d be a good idea to find and talk with multiple sugar glider owners and do extensive research before purchasing. There is not as much information on these creatures as there are for other pets. They have only recently been imported into the United States and many vets are unfamiliar with them. Some states have even outlawed owning them altogether. Many groups don’t think it should be legal for them to be owned as pets. There is, actually, a lot of controversy surrounding this species. Many people purchase one and realize that they made a mistake once they bring it home. If you are thinking about getting a sugar glider then make sure you know what you are getting into. They do make great pets to those who can commit to them. Sugar Gliders can be aggressive, need lots of attention, and live between 7 and 15 years.
